The door head is designed with folding time and space, and a double curtain hangs under the wooden eaves-the outer layer is a rice-white linen tea flag, the gold stamp official script reads the word Day Tea, and the inner layer is an indigo dyed cloth wine flag, the Ukiyo-e style clear wine pot pattern is looming. The left wall is based on the landscape of dry mountains and rivers, and is embedded with a combination sculpture of bronze tea pots and wine spoons. In the wooden window lattice on the right, Matcha tea bowls and fruits are displayed during the day. After night, it is replaced by Rex sacrificial wine bottles and burning wine cups., the light changes from warm yellow to dark blue. The double-decked cabinet at the door hides secrets: the upper layer is filled with bamboo tea pots and lacquerware wine cups, and the lower drawer is filled with menus for different periods of time. The electronic screen above the lintel plays ink animations cyclically. At noon, it is a picture of boiling tea, and at night it switches to slow motion of sake being poured into a cup. The stone lantern at the door is covered with moss marks and green plants during the day. When it is lit at night, it will tea and wine symbiosis The Zen meaning of symbiosis is embellished on the bluestone steps, perfectly interpreting the day and night variation from matcha to sake.
